WebJul 12, 2024 · It was the radio show which first coined the use of "truth, justice and the American way", at a time when all three things seemed in short supply. By then, America was embroiled in World War II with no clear victory in sight. Interestingly enough, the "the American way" was apparently dropped by the radio show in 1944, after the tide turned in ...
